
Designed to Be Red: Native American & Indigenous Poster Works
Sep 25, 2026 – Feb 21, 2027
About
Curated by designer and Monacan Indian Nation member Brian Johnson, the exhibition surveys nearly two centuries of Native graphic design representing more than 60 tribes and nations, countering a history in which outside marketers used graphic design to tell stories about Native Americans rather than with them. Work by Melanie Cervantes, Jeffrey Gibson, Ryan Red Corn, Crystal Worl, and organizations including Akwesasne Notes shows designers using posters for activism, cultural pride, and institutional identity.
